| 20100084567 | Chromatic Aberration Corrector for Charged-Particle Beam System and Correction Method Therefor - An aberration corrector has two stages of multipole elements each of which has a thickness along the optical axis. Each multipole element produces a static electric or magnetic field of 3-fold symmetry and a static electromagnetic field of 2- or 3-fold symmetry superimposed on the static electric or magnetic field. In each of the multipole elements, the static electromagnetic field is so set that magnetic and electric deflecting forces on an electron beam accelerated by a given accelerating voltage substantially cancel out each other. Thus, chromatic aberration is corrected. Also, spherical aberration is corrected by the static electric or magnetic fields of 3-fold symmetry produced by the multipole elements. | 04-08-2010 |

| 20110090034 | OIL IMMERSED ELECTRICAL APPARATUS - An oil immersed electrical apparatus such as an oil immersed transformer that can detect copper sulfide precipitated on coil insulating paper is provided. In the oil immersed transformer in which a coil with its surface covered by insulating paper is arranged in a container filled with insulating oil, a detection member is prepared by providing two electrodes on a surface of a plate-like pressboard formed of cellulose, which is a same material as that of the insulating paper, this detection member is arranged in contact with the insulating oil, and generation of copper sulfide is detected from reduction in a surface resistance between the electrodes. The temperature of the detection member is set higher than the temperature of the coil so that copper sulfide is generated thereon prior to generation of copper sulfide on a coil unit. | 04-21-2011 |

| 20090256331 | Vehicle - By bending and stretching a link mechanism, both left and right wheels of a vehicle can be inclined toward inside of cornering to generate a camber thrust as a lateral force, i.e. an increase in cornering force. Further, by bending and stretching the link mechanism, the passenger compartment can be inclined in accordance with inclination of a connecting link, and thus the center of gravity of the vehicle can be moved toward its inner wheel during cornering. By preventing lifting of the inner wheel during cornering, cornering performance is improved. Because the passenger compartment is inclined toward the inner wheel during cornering, centrifugal force is less likely to be felt by the occupant. | 10-15-2009 |
